简介
Matrix-ApkChecker 作为 Matrix 系统的一部分,是针对 android 安装包的分析
检测工具,根据一系列设定好的规则检测 apk 是否存在特定的问题,并输出较
为详细的检测结果报告,用于分析排查问题以及版本追踪。
• 官方文档
• Matrix Github
使用
运行前准备工作
1. 从官方地址下载 ApkChecker.jar (本次使用 matrix-apk-canary-
2.0.2.jar)
2. 准备配置文件 config.json ,下面是配置文件(与官方文档示例有区
别,具体配置根据自己项目需求)
{
"--apk":"C:/Users/John/Desktop/debug/AiGuPiao-debug.apk", // 配置成
自己绝对路径
"--output":"C:/Users/John/Desktop/debug/apk-checker-result",// 配置
成自己绝对路径
"--format":"mm.html,mm.json",
"--formatConfig":
[
{
"name":"-countMethod",
"group":
[
{
"name":"Android System",
"package":"android"
},
{
"name":"java system",
"package":"java"
},
{
"name":"com.tencent.test.$",// 配置成项目包名
"package":"com.tencent.test.$"// 配置成项目包名
}
]
}